Certifications Available from
RLT Dive Center
PADI Bubblemaker
Children
between the ages of 8 to 11 can now try scuba
with PADI's new Bubblemaker program. In the
program a child can experience scuba in a
pool with a certified instructor. Students
will be allowed to go down 6 ft and experience
scuba for themselves.
PADI Scuba Diver
This
pre-entry level course enables you to dive to 40
ft. with a Divemaster or higher. PADI Scuba
divers can continue their course to become an
Open Water Diver within a year of becoming a
Scuba Diver.
PADI Open Water Diver Course
This is a pre-requisite entry level course that will provide you with the skills to visit the underwater world. Once completed, you will have learned all the basic skills to dive safely to a depth of 60 feet. This course is in three segments: Academic training, Confined-water training, and (Open-water training (additional charge for Open Water)). Successful completion is eligible for 1 hour college credit through the ACE program. Transcript expense is the responsibilty of student.
PADI Advanced Open Water Course
This course is for divers having achieved their Open Water Certification. The course consists of two parts, Advanced Open Water and Advanced Plus Course. Both courses develop your underwater skills and give you a taste of specialty diving activities. The scope and duration of the specialties varies with your interest level. There are three core dive requirements; night dive, deep dive (100 feet), and navigation dive.
